    This is not entirely true. It is a deceptive practice. I went to a hair doctor for a free consultation. The consultant explained the different procedures they offer. One of them is the PRP procedure shown above in the video. If you choose the PRP procedure, you have to keep going back every year. If you stop going, your hair will start falling out. That means, you will be shelling out a few thousand dollars every year for your new hair.

      His is most likely genetic, and I'm sure he's on Finesteride, which blocks the DHT hormone that causes hairloss in People genetically sensitive to it.
      But this treatment looks like it's for people with Tension Alopecia, which is when you excessively, and tightly tie up your hair (top knots/buns, tight ponytails, braids, that are then tied up, slicking hair back with boars hair brush & gel before tying it up, ect. This happens because you're putting the weight of ALL of your hair on the hairline, namely the temples and front of your hairline.)
      It's not like plucking a hair, where the hairs tend to grow back, that's a quick process that CAN damage the papilla(where the growth of a hair starts), but usually doesn't because it's a clean break between the hair shaft and the papilla.
      Instead, Tension Alopecia is like prolonged strangulation of the papilla, because you're slowly overtime putting more and more stress, weight and tension on the papilla, which IS connected to the hair durring the growth phase(Anagen,which is the stage hairs are in 90% of the time & lasts for 2-7 years). That stress causes it to either go dormant into a vellius stage, or outright die.
      To know if yours are dormant or dead, you can try shining a bright light at an angle towards your hairline while looking in a mirror.
      If you see those small "peachfuz" hairs, yours are dormant and this platelet therapy will probably work (and almost always will work on Women).
      If you DON'T see those vellius hairs, right up against your hairline, this treatment likely won't do you any good, and your best bet would probably be talking to a specialist, a hair transplant, and lifelong finesteride(stoping if you're ever "ready to go bald")
